The idea of a dark side, the evil inclination, whatever it is in humans that allows them to commit evil, to be cruel or wicked or bad or possess vices and desires, is a fascinating one. The mind is drawn to the idea of wickedness, paints it in attractive shades of black and red, fantasizes about the forbidden and its allure.

Judaism has a very interesting view of the evil inclination, one that does not entirely subscribe to the romantic portrait we paint of it. First, the evil inclination is internal, second, it has its balance, the good inclination. What, then, is the evil inclination, and where do we find it?
